Job opening: IT Specialist (INFOSEC)

Salary: $69 107 - 89 835 per year
Published at: Sep 12 2023
Employment Type: Full-time
About the Position: This position is a DOD Cyber Excepted Service (CES) personnel system position in the Excepted Service under 10 USC 1599f. Employees occupying CES positions are in the Excepted Service and must adhere to U.S. Code, Title 10, as well as Department of Defense Instruction 1400.25. This position is located at the Fort Bliss, TX .

Duties

Periodically reviews the status of all information systems. Responsible for ordering, receiving, issuing, inventorying, replacing, and returning COMSEC material and equipment. Responsible for performing and/or overseeing selected managerial aspects of the Cybersecurity program for the Installation Computing Environment. Ensure published guidance follows Federal laws, Executive Orders, Department of Defense (DoD) and Department of the Army (DA) directives and regulations. Implement the site-based Risk Management Framework (RMF) assessment and authorization program.

Requirements

  • This position requires the incumbent be able to obtain and maintain a determination of eligibility for a Secret security clearance or access for the duration of employment.
  • Three-year probationary period may be required.
  • This position requires the incumbent to possess, obtain and maintain an IT Level II Security+ certification within 6 months of employment.
  • Temporary Duty (TDY) business travel is required approximately 20% of the time.
  • This position requires the completion of a pre-employment Physical Examination and an annual examination thereafter.
  • The duties of this position require the incumbent to possess or obtain and maintain a valid state Driver's License in one of the 50 U.S. states or possessions to operate vehicles.
  • Incumbent must sign statement acknowledging this is an Excepted Service position that does not confer competitive status.
  • Overtime and shift work may be required on short notice to include nights, holidays, and weekends in support of related mission requirements.

Basic Requirement for IT Specialist (INFOSEC): To qualify based on your experience, your resume must describe one year of specialized experience that demonstrates the possession of knowledge, skills, abilities, and competencies necessary for immediate success in the position. Such experience is typically in or directly related to the work of the position to be filled. Specialized experience would be demonstrated by developing and enforcing procedures, policies, and regulation for protection of Communication Security equipment, materials, and aids; coordinating assessment and authorization activities for Risk Management Framework (RMF) for all enclave information technology; preparing, managing, and implementing assessment and authorization requirements which may also include Army Portfolio Management System (APMS), Federal Information Systems Management Act (FISMA), Army IT metrics; Inspect Traditional Security/TEMPEST and PDS Protected Distribution System. The specialized experience must include, or be supplemented by, information technology related experience (paid or unpaid experience and/or completion of specific, intensive training, as appropriate) which demonstrates each of the four competencies, as defined: (1) Attention to Detail - Is thorough when performing work and conscientious about attending to detail. Examples of IT-related experience demonstrating this competency include: completing work independently that rarely requires editing or review by others. (2) Customer Service - Works with clients and customers (that is, any individuals who use or receive the services or products that your work unit produces, including the general public, individuals who work in the agency, other agencies, or organizations outside the Government) to assess their needs, provide information or assistance, resolve their problems, or satisfy their expectations; knows about available products and services; is committed to providing quality products and services. Examples of IT-related experience demonstrating this competency include: resolving simple and routine problems, questions, or complaints and providing support and guidance to customers on non-routine issues; serving as a primary resource for customers, requesting assistance with complex issues when necessary; and participating in meetings and providing advice to customers in own area of expertise. (3) Oral Communication - Expresses information (for example, ideas or facts) to individuals or groups effectively, taking into account the audience and nature of the information (for example, technical, sensitive, controversial); makes clear and convincing oral presentations; listens to others, attends to nonverbal cues, and responds appropriately. Examples of IT-related experience demonstrating this competency include: expressing facts and ideas in a clear, concise, convincing, and organized manner; clearly conveying moderately complex ideas, concepts, and information to customers; exhibiting active listening by demonstrating understanding of audience comments and/or questions. (4) Problem Solving - Identifies problems; determines accuracy and relevance of information; uses sound judgment to generate and evaluate alternatives, and to make recommendations. Examples of IT-related experience demonstrating this competency include: identifying and solving problems by gathering and applying information from a variety of materials or sources that provide several alternatives; recognizing and taking action to address non-routine problems; soliciting feedback from multiple stakeholders to understand an issue or problem and accurately assess its root causes and potential solutions; seeking supervisory review where appropriate. OR Education: Ph.D. or equivalent doctoral degree or 3 full years of progressively higher level graduate education leading to such a degree from an accredited or pre-accredited institution in computer science, engineering, information science, information systems management, mathematics, operations research, statistics, or technology management; or, three full years of graduate education from an accredited or pre-accredited institution that provided a minimum of 24 semester hours in one or more of the fields identified above and required the development or adaptation of applications, systems, or networks.
